Constantine I BEATA TRANQVILLITAS from Trier
« on: August 22, 2016, 08:59:19 AM »
Here is another ex-Elberling coin, circa 1860

This series is unlisted in RIC for the H1 bust, though there is an example of the H2 (with spear and shield). It should come after Trier 391. It is in RMBT as #156.

Constantine I
A.D. 323
20mm   2.0gm
CONSTAN-TINVS AVG; helmeted and cuirassed, with spear across right shoulder.
BEATA TRANQ-VILLITAS; globe set on altar inscribed VO/TIS/XX; above, three stars.
in ex. • PTR crescent
RIC VII Trier -- ; RMBT 156
